Posted by: Mr. Babatunde« on: October 09, 2020, 05:53:34 PM »Many protesters of # EndSARS have been confirmed to have blocked a highway in Lagos state. According to The Nation, the protestors took over the Alausa Secretariat expressway, which serves as a main route for commuters. On the ever-busy highway, hundreds of commuters were left stranded. The youths barricaded the highway, singing songs of unity that paralyzed vehicular and human movements and triggered road gridlocks. The demonstrators, bearing placards with different inscriptions, called for the disbandment of the Special Anti-Robbery Squad (SARS) over suspected civilians being abused and extrajudicially murdered.
